Nepal’s COVID-19 death toll reaches 84 after octogenarian dies in Saptari



KATHMANDU: One more person has died from coronavirus in Saptari district. With this, the number of coronavirus deaths in Nepal has reached 84.

An 80-year-old man of Dakneshwori municipality-8 died on Tuesday, said District Health Office, Saptari.

He had been suffering from fever for the last four days.  He was confirmed infected after his swab sample test result came out positive on Tuesday night.

The octogenarian died wile being rushed to isolation of the hospital after he was confirmed to have been infected with the coronavirus, according to the District Health Office, Saptari.

He had been suffering from cardiac arrest, thyroid, high blood pressure and diabetes.

Earlier, a 45-year-old man of Rupani rural municipality and 72-year-old male had died from COVID-19 in the district.

With this the number of people to have died from COVID-19 has reached three in Saptari district and 84 in Nepal.
